Seasons

1. Alone at Last
Nao moves into her own apartment, but a male classmate shows up and says he's the real tenant. They find a solution but it won't be easy to pull off.

2. A Kiss to Remember
Nao is still reeling from the morning's events but Uehara doesn't remember a thing. Marina suspects something is up and starts asking questions.

3. Rumor Has It
Nao tends to Hisashi, who is hospitalized from overworking. A mysterious woman appears. Rumors buzz at school that Hisashi and Nao are an item.

4. Christmas is Coming
With Christmas Eve fast approaching, an unfortunate encounter with a delivery boy leads Nao to a new job, where she meets Abe, the "confession king."

5. Party of One
A confession to Abe confuses Nao's relationship with Uehara further. Later, she hears that he'll be spending New Year's with his coworker, Nanako.

6. Faking Up is Hard to Do
At Marina's suggestion, Nao and Uehara eat lunch bento together in public. It's fun, but she wonders if he's thinking of Yuri when they're together.

7. Baby, It's Cold Outside
Yuri announces she's getting divorced and asks to stay at the apartment. Uehara goes home to his brother, leaving Yuri and Nao to live alone together.

8. He's Not Sexy, He's My Brother
Uehara's older brother, Takuya, tries to explain himself, but Yuri isn't having it and throws away her wedding ring. Nao works to help them reconcile.

9. A Valentine Surprise
Nao overhears Uehara talking about his feelings for her. Too flummoxed to respond, she avoids him. Marina suggests a Valentine's Day date.

10. A Change of Scenery
Nao finds out Yuri stayed overnight and announces she'll be moving out. Daichi calls Uehara to a one-on-one meeting on the school rooftop.

11. Father Knows Best
The parents find out the truth and Uehara leaves to live at home. When her father cancels the contract, Nao runs away and Uehara goes to face him.

12. Tagging Along
In an effort to rebuff Yukari's overtures, Icchan claims Nao is his girlfriend. Uehara overhears, but his lack of a reaction worries Nao.

13. The Getaway (1)
Transfer student Nozomi Kitaura confronts Nao on the rooftop and shares her feelings about Uehara. Worried, Nao plans a special date with him.

14. The Getaway (2)
Uehara’s presence alone puts Nao on cloud nine, but Issei throws her looks with mixed feelings. By chance, Nao is paired with Issei for a dare night.

15. Surprise!
After the trip, Nao is hospitalized for food poisoning and meets a kind college student. She learns that Uehara has been having a cute girl over.

16. Two is Company...
Issei has moved into the apartment after a family fight. Marina has her eye on a visiting college student, whom Nao recognizes from the hospital.

17. A Modest Proposal
Nao mistakenly assumes Uehara will propose to her, and engagement rumors spread throughout the school. After he denies it to her face, she collapses.

Svenska dialektmysterier
Svenska dialektmysterier was a Swedish television series about Swedish dialects. It was hosted by Fredrik Lindström and produced by Marcos Hellberg and broadcast on SVT2 in January–March 2006. The programme can be seen as a continuation of Värsta språket, another series hosted by Lindström. It won the television award Kristallen in the infotainment category.
